JavaSE学习笔记
文章目录

Java 基础篇
序号 | 内容 | 链接地址 |
---|---|---|
1 | Java概述 | 链接地址 |
2 | Java环境搭建 | 链接地址 |
3 | Java基础概念 | 链接地址 |
4 | Java基础语法 | 链接地址 |
Java 面向对象篇
序号 | 内容 | 链接地址 |
---|---|---|
1 | 面向对象概述 | 链接地址 |
2 | 类与对象 | 链接地址 |
3 | 继承 | 链接地址 |
4 | 重写与重载 | 链接地址 |
5 | 多态 | 链接地址 |
6 | 抽象 | 链接地址 |
7 | 封装 | 链接地址 |
8 | 包 | 链接地址 |
9 | 泛型 | 链接地址 |
10 | 异常 | 链接地址 |
Java 进阶篇
序号 | 内容 | 链接地址 |
---|---|---|
1 | Java核心Api | 链接地址 |
2 | Java集合框架接口 | 链接地址 |
3 | List实现类 | 链接地址 |
4 | Set实现类 | 链接地址 |
5 | Map实现类 | 链接地址 |
6 | 常见接口 | 链接地址 |
Java 高级篇
序号 | 内容 | 链接地址 |
---|---|---|
1 | IO流 | 链接地址 |
2 | 多线程 | 链接地址 |
3 | 网络编程 | 链接地址 |
4 | Json | 链接地址 |
5 | Xml | 链接地址 |
6 | 反射 | 链接地址 |
7 | 注解 | 链接地址 |
8 | 枚举 | 链接地址 |
9 | Java8新特性 | 链接地址 |
Java源码分析篇
HashMap源码分析
序号 | 内容 | 链接地址 |
---|---|---|
1 | HashMap的继承体系,HashMap的内部类,成员变量 | 链接地址 |
2 | HashMap的常见方法的实现流程 | 链接地址 |
3 | HashMap的一些特定算法,常量的分析 | 链接地址 |
4 | HashMap的线程安全问题(1.7和1.8) | 链接地址 |
5 | HashMap的线程安全问题解决方案 | 链接地址 |
6 | Map的四种遍历方式,以及删除操作 | 链接地址 |
7 | HashMap1.7和1.8的区别 | 链接地址 |
synchronized源码分析
序号 | 内容 | 链接地址 |
---|---|---|
1 | 初探jvm指令 | 链接地址 |
2 | java对象头 | 链接地址 |
3 | CAS | 链接地址 |
4 | synchronized原理 | 链接地址 |
5 | 锁升级 | 链接地址 |
AQS源码分析篇
TODO
序号 | 内容 | 链接地址 |
---|---|---|
1 | JUC的学习顺序 | 链接地址 |
2 | AQS的入门案例 | 链接地址 |
3 | AQS的继承体系,内部类,成员变量 | 链接地址 |
4 | AQS的常用方法 | 链接地址 |
5 | AQS的加锁解锁原理 | 链接地址 |
6 | AQS的锁的实现子类 |
线程池源码分析篇
TODO
序号 | 内容 | 链接地址 |
---|---|---|
1 | 线程池概述 | 链接地址 |
2 | 线程池继承体系,内部类,成员变量 | |
3 | 线程池的常用方法 | |
4 | 线程池工作原理 | |
5 | 常用的线程池实现类 | |
6 | 线程池相关面试题 |